from seleniumimport webdriver#用来驱动浏览器的from selenium.webdriverimport ActionChains#破解滑动验证码的时候用的 可以拖动图片from selenium.webdriver.common.byimport By#按照什么方式查找,By.ID,By.CSS_SELECTORfrom selenium.webdriver.com
异常处理详细文档:http://selenium-python.readthedocs.io/api.html#module-selenium.common.exceptions
selenium 是一套完整的web应用程序测试系统,包含了测试的录制(selenium IDE),编写及运行(Selenium Remote Control)和测试的并行处理(Selenium Grid)。Selenium的核心Selenium Core基于JsUnit,完全由JavaScript编写,因此可以用于任何支持JavaScript的浏览器上。 selenium可以模拟真实浏览器,自动化测试工具,支持多种浏览器,爬虫...
Selenium是开源的自动化测试工具,它主要是用于Web 应用程序的自动化测试,不只局限于此,同时支持所有基于web 的管理任务自动化。 Selenium 官网:https://www.seleniumhq.org/ Selenium Github 主页:https:///SeleniumHQ/selenium 1.安装 Selenium 工具包: 由于 安装好的 Python 默认有 pip (Python 包管理工具),可以...
Selenium 是web自动化测试工具集,包括IDE、Grid、RC(selenium 1.0)、WebDriver(selenium 2.0)等,主要用于Web应用程序的自动化测试。 关系 2、特点 开源、免费;支持多浏览器、多平台、多语言;对Web页面有良好支持;API简单灵活; 支持分布式测试用例执行。
1.2、Selenium是什么? Selenium是一个用于Web应用程序测试的工具。Selenium测试直接运行在浏览器中,就像真正的用户在操作一样。支持的浏览器包括IE(7, 8, 9, 10, 11),Mozilla Firefox,Safari,Google Chrome,Opera,Edge等。这个工具的主要功能包括:测试与浏览器的兼容性——测试应用程序看是否能够很好的工作在不同浏...
一、什么是selenium? selenium是个强大的工具集。支持快速开发测试自动化,支持在多种浏览器平台上执行测试。支持多开发语言,如:Python、Java、ruby、C#等,本次选择Python3作为开发语言。 二、用python做测试的优点 学习难度小,开发周期短。对目前国内大多数测试人员来说,编码经验不足,python是个很好的入门语言。胶水...
一selenium是什么? 引用百度百科的介绍selenium的一段话: “Selenium是一个用于Web应用程序测试的工具。Selenium测试直接运行在浏览器中,就像真正的用户在操作一样。支持的浏览器包括IE(7, 8, 9, 10, 11),Mozilla Firefox,Safari,Google Chrome,Opera等。这个工具的主要功能包括:测试与浏览器的兼容性——测试你的...
Selenium。Selenium 是一个开源自动化框架,可以在 Python 或 Java、C#、PHP 和其他语言中工作。它改进了应用程序的测试过程。 BeautifulSoup。BeautifulSoup 是一种流行的数据抓取工具,供需要收集大量信息的 Python 开发人员使用,Python爬虫经常会用到这个库。